在数据库查询语言SQL中,”SELECT”语句用于从数据库表中选择数据。对数函数的运算法则涉及乘法、除法、乘方和开方等操作。将这两者结合,可能是讨论如何在SQL查询中应用数学运算,特别是对数运算,来处理或筛选数据。
1. 积的对数
两个正数的积的对数,等于同一底数的这两个数的对数的和,如果有正数A和B,那么对数运算法则表明 log_c(A * B) = log_c(A) + log_c(B),其中c是底数。
2. 商的对数
两个正数商的对数,等于被除数的对数减去除数的对数,如果有两个正数A和B,则 log_c(A / B) = log_c(A) log_c(B),这个法则在处理比例问题时非常有用。
3. 幂的对数
一个数的幂的对数,等于该数的对数乘以幂,对于任何正数A和整数n,有 log_c(A^n) = n * log_c(A),这在科学计算中尤其重要,如计算化学反应速率或声音的强度。
4. 方根的对数
方根的对数,等于原数的对数除以根号下的数字,具体地,对于任意正数A和整数n,有 log_c(√[A]) = log_c(A) / n,这在工程学和物理学中常见,如计算振幅和波动。
5. 特殊值
对数运算中有几个特殊值非常重要:首先是lne=1,这意味着自然对数e的任何次幂都是其自身;其次是ln1=0,即任何数的0次幂都等于1的对数为0,这些特殊值在公式推导和简化中扮演关键角色。
通过以上五点,我们可以看到对数函数不仅是数学中的一个基本概念,而且它们的运算法则在实际问题解决中具有广泛的应用价值,了解并掌握这些基本的运算法则,可以帮助我们更好地理解和运用对数函数进行复杂问题的求解,从而在科学研究、工程设计和数据分析等多个领域中发挥重要作用。
### 【集合运算SELECT】
集合运算中的SELECT操作是一种基本的数据查询操作,用于从数据库表中选取满足特定条件的行,这种操作与对数运算法则虽然属于不同的数学领域,但在数据处理和信息检索方面同样重要,下面将简要介绍SELECT操作的基本语法和用途。
**SELECT语句**:SELECT语句是SQL语言中最常用的一种指令,它允许用户指定需要查询的列,以及这些列来自哪些表,还可以添加条件表达式来过滤结果。
**FROM子句**:FROM子句指定了SELECT语句所查询的表,这是查询数据的来源,可以是一个或多个表。
**WHERE子句**:WHERE子句用于设置查询条件,只有满足这些条件的记录才会被选取并显示在结果集中。
**GROUP BY子句**:当需要根据一个或多个列对结果集进行分组时,使用GROUP BY子句,这通常与聚合函数(如COUNT, SUM, AVG等)一起使用。
**HAVING子句**:HAVING子句类似于WHERE子句,但它是在聚合后的数据上应用条件,而不是单个记录。
**ORDER BY子句**:ORDER BY子句用于指定结果集的排序方式,可以通过列名来指定按哪一列的值进行升序或降序排列。
虽然对数函数的运算法则和集合运算SELECT操作属于不同的数学和计算机科学范畴,但它们都是处理数据和解决问题的重要工具,了解并掌握这些基本的操作和规则,不仅可以增强我们的理论基础,还可以在实际应用中提高我们的问题解决能力。
### FAQs
Q1: 对数函数的定义域是什么?
A1: 对数函数y=log_a(x)的定义域是所有正实数,即{x | x > 0},这是因为对数定义中只对正数有意义,任何非正数(包括0和负数)都不在对数函数的定义域内。
Q2: 如何理解对数的基本运算法则?
A2: 对数的基本运算法则可以从指数的角度来理解,两个数的积的对数等于它们各自对数的和,是因为指数运算中基数相乘相当于指数相加;而一个数的幂的对数等于该数的对数乘以幂,是因为指数运算中基数的幂相当于对数的乘法,这些法则简化了对数的计算过程,使得涉及乘除和乘方的运算更加直观易懂。
下面是一个简化的介绍,展示了对数函数的基本运算法则以及它们在集合运算SELECT中的应用。
对数函数运算法则 | 数学表达式 | SQL中的集合运算SELECT示例 |
和法则 | log(a) + log(b) = log(a * b) | SELECT log(columnA) + log(columnB) AS LogSum FROM table |
差法则 | log(a) log(b) = log(a / b) | SELECT log(columnA) log(columnB) AS LogDifference FROM table |
幂法则 | log(a^b) = blog(a) | SELECT power(log(columnA), columnB) AS LogPower FROM table 注意这里使用了幂函数,因为SQL中没有直接的对数幂运算 |
积法则 | log(ab) = log(a) + log(b) | SELECT log(columnA * columnB) AS LogProduct FROM table |
商法则 | log(a/b) = log(a) log(b) | SELECT log(columnA / columnB) AS LogQuotient FROM table |
请注意,SQL中的实际操作可能需要根据具体数据库系统支持的函数和语法进行调整。
SQL中使用对数函数时,通常假设对数的底数是自然对数的底数e(约等于2.71828),除非数据库提供特定的对数函数并允许指定底数,如果数据库支持LOG函数并允许指定底数,那么上述示例可能需要相应的修改来指定正确的底数。
本文来源于互联网,如若侵权,请联系管理员删除,本文链接:https://www.9969.net/13245.html